%0 Journal Article %T Forensic Diagnosis of Acute Myocardial Infarction: Application of Mass Spectrometry SciDoc Publishers | Open Access | Science Journals | Media Partners %A Kakimoto Y %A Tsuruyama T %J Forensic Science & Pathology (IJFP) %D 2018 %R http://dx.doi.org/10.19070/2332-287X-1400018 %X Making a precise diagnosis of sudden death due to endogenous acute myocardial infarction in autopsy can be difficult, because histologic myocardial changes and other clinical data are limited. Here, we review previous studies of acute myocardial infarction for pathologic diagnosis using triphenyltetrazolium chloride staining and immunohistochemistry. Further, we introduce our method of forensic examination by mass spectrometry and a novel promising biomarker, SORBS2 for diagnosis of acute lethal cardiac infarction %K n/a %U https://scidoc.org/IJFP-2332-287X-02-802.php
